當我嘗試在我的iPhone運行,下面的代碼,我收到以下錯誤 rrr.swift:356:72: Ambiguous use of 'subscript'
奇怪的是它只有當我想要運行的應用情況在電話上,在模擬器上,但它工作正常。 有3行導致錯誤的地方。我在下面的代碼中用大寫字母指出了它們。 我嘗試訪問JSON數組內的數組中的屬性,我懷疑我是以錯誤的方式做它,但不知道如何解決它。 如何在沒有下標錯
我想要這樣做:使用字符串枚舉訪問我的字典值。我試圖超載字典的下標,但沒有成功。 訪問詞典: let district = address[JsonKeys.district]
其中JsonKeys是: enum JsonKeys: String {
case key1
case key2
case key...
}
,我的下標超載情況如下: extensio
錯誤1: 當我試圖獲取元數據中的stringValue顯示上述錯誤在Swift3: let myMetadata: AVMetadataMachineReadableCodeObject = metadataObjects[0] as! AVMetadataMachineReadableCodeObject
// take out the system and check-digits
le
因此,根據以下項目教程expandableCells,使用NSMutableArray的子腳本工作。 (我自己在xcode中打開了項目,並且沒有錯誤) 當我嘗試在我自己的項目中使用這個工作流程時,我得到了「模糊使用下標」錯誤。這是在上一個問題Ambiguous use of subscript 我的問題是爲什麼項目提供的appcoda在xcode中工作,但類似的代碼不工作時嘗試在新項目中使用類
我幾乎用電子表格完成了比較兩個數組以及任何在一個數組中但不在另一個數組中的任何數據都放入第三個數組的情況。 然後我想將數組中的值放到工作簿的一個工作表上的單元格中,但即使數組在調試器中顯示了一個值,我也會得到一個下標超出範圍。 這裏是循環打印數組: If (Not MissingLoans) = -1 Then
ThisWorkbook.Sheets("Inputs and Result